Why Documentation Matters in Divorce
Property division is one of the most contested aspects of divorce proceedings. Without clear documentation, disputes can arise over what items exist, their value, and who should receive them. A comprehensive inventory created before tensions escalate provides an objective reference point that attorneys, mediators, and courts can rely on.
Items are sometimes moved, hidden, or "forgotten" during contentious divorces. Having timestamped photos and detailed valuations creates a record that protects your interests and supports fair division of marital property.
